Output 7e2d689100dc5ace31754fe45f29602a21ebc00a03668d3063033ef860dcff55:0

value
28757712
script pubkey
OP_0 OP_PUSHBYTES_20 cce405a51ef03920f42fe129a9faa252dda72cce
address
bc1qenjqtfg77qujpap0uy56n74z2tw6wtxw4dl6a8
transaction
7e2d689100dc5ace31754fe45f29602a21ebc00a03668d3063033ef860dcff55
confirmations
167083
spent
true